Product Overview

Ethernet Enablement for Legacy Serial Infrastructure

HERON Gateway P2 is an industrial Modbus gateway designed to connect legacy RS-485 serial devices to Ethernet networks. The device bridges four RS-485 channels to one 10/100 Mbps Ethernet interface, enabling centralized monitoring, protocol conversion, secure configuration, and remote maintenance for distributed industrial assets.

The gateway supports Modbus RTU, Modbus ASCII, and Modbus TCP for integration between serial field devices and Ethernet-based control systems. It also supports MQTT v3.1.1 and v5.0, allowing selected data to be published to SCADA platforms and control data to be subscribed from external systems.

HERON Gateway P2 provides HTTPS web management, user access control, event logging, LED diagnostics, hardware watchdog support, and signed OTA firmware update over Ethernet. With fanless operation, IP40-rated plastic enclosure, and DIN rail mounting, it is well suited for industrial control and monitoring environments.

Isolation built-in — power isolation (2–2.5 kV DC-DC converter), RS-485 surge protection, and transformer-coupled Ethernet galvanic isolation protect gateway and connected devices from ground loops and transients.

Specifications

Technical Specifications

Ethernet Interface

7 parameters
Port Quantity1 × Ethernet port
ConnectorRJ45
Speed10/100 Mbps
Ethernet FeaturesAuto-negotiation, auto-crossover
Supported Network ProtocolsTCP, UDP, ARP, ICMP, HTTP/HTTPS, DHCP, DNS
Operating ModesTCP Server, TCP Client, UDP Server, UDP Client
Ethernet IsolationTransformer-coupled galvanic isolation

Gateway Functions

8 parameters
Supported ProtocolsModbus RTU, Modbus ASCII, Modbus TCP
Modbus Operating ModesRTU Master, RTU Slave, TCP Client, TCP Server
Modbus TCP Master SessionsUp to 16 concurrent TCP master connections
MQTT Supportv3.1.1 and v5.0, publish/subscribe, QoS 0/1/2, retain, TLS
Web ManagementHTTPS-based configuration and management
OTA Firmware UpdateSigned remote firmware update over Ethernet
On-Board Data LoggingLocal non-volatile circular retention log
Diagnostics and MonitoringHardware watchdog, event log, and front-panel LED indicators

Serial Port Specifications

12 parameters
Number of Channels4 × RS-485
StandardTIA / EIA-485-A, 2-wire half-duplex
Connector per Port2-pin pluggable screw terminal
SignalsD+, D−
Direction ControlAutomatic RS-485 data-flow direction control
Baud Rate300 to 460800 bps
Data Bits5, 6, 7, 8
Stop Bits1, 2
ParityNone, Even, Odd
Flow ControlSoftware (XON/XOFF)
Termination120 Ω, software-selectable per port
Fail-Safe BiasInternal, optional per port

Isolation & Protection

3 parameters
Power Isolation2–2.5 kV isolated DC-DC converter
RS-485 Surge ProtectionSupported
Ethernet IsolationTransformer-coupled galvanic isolation

Mechanical & Environmental

9 parameters
Input Voltage12–28 VDC
Input ProtectionReverse-polarity protection, fuse, and TVS protection
Housing MaterialPlastic
Protection RatingIP40
MountingDIN rail mounting
CoolingFanless, natural convection
Dimensions (W × H × D)22.5 × 101 × 119 mm
Operating Temperature-20 °C to +50 °C
Operating Humidity5% to 95% RH, non-condensing

Applications

Designed for Real Industrial Deployments

PLC Control Systems

Connect Siemens, Allen-Bradley, Schneider, and other Modbus-capable PLCs to your Ethernet control network — without replacing the existing serial wiring.

Utility Cabinets

Bridge energy meters, power analyzers, and protection relays in MV/LV panels to SCADA or building management systems over a single Ethernet connection.

Environmental Monitoring

Aggregate temperature, humidity, and gas sensors spread across large sites — all reading via RS-485 Modbus into one network-visible data point.

Building Automation

Integrate HVAC controllers, lighting systems, and access control units on RS-485 into BMS dashboards using standard Modbus polling over Ethernet.

Measuring Instruments

Read flow meters, pressure transmitters, and multi-function analyzers in process plants directly via Modbus RTU — no separate data logger required.
